The Cost of Attending Edgecombe Community College?

Cost of attendance at Edgecombe Community College varied between $12,607.00 to $18,751.00 depending on whether you qualify for in-state rates.

Where you live mattered — in-state students paid less than out-of-state students: close to $12,607.00 for in-state students versus $18,751.00 out-of-state.

The three scenarios below move from the full sticker price, to the net price after average aid, to the net price low-income students typically pay.

Sticker Cost for Residents (no aid)

Tuition and fees $2,640.00
+ Room, board & other expenses $9,967.00
Total cost $12,607.00
That is 35% below the national average net price.

What Students Actually Pay — Residents (with average aid)

Total cost $12,607.00
− Grants and scholarships −$9,330.00
Net price $3,277.00
That is 83% below the national average net price.

Cost for Non-Residents (no aid)

Tuition and fees $8,784.00
+ Room, board & other expenses $9,967.00
Total cost $18,751.00
That is 3% below the national average net price.

Net Price for Non-Residents (with average aid)

Total cost $18,751.00
− Grants and scholarships −$9,330.00
Net price $9,421.00
That is 51% below the national average net price.

Net Price — What Students Actually Pay at Edgecombe Community College

Net price reflects the true cost to attend after grant and scholarship aid is deducted. For most prospective students, net price gives a more realistic estimate than sticker tuition.

Average net price (off-campus) $8,098.00

What families actually pay shifts with income, since need-based grants are larger for lower-income students. Here is the average net price for each family-income range:

Family income Average net price
Under $30,000 $4,748.00
$30,000 to $48,000 $5,507.00
$48,001 to $75,000 $9,792.00
$75,001 to $110,000 $10,565.00

Student Debt at Edgecombe Community College

Typical debt at graduation from Edgecombe Community College comes to $9,500.00, which federal data classifies as a Very Low (<$10k) debt-load classification.

Here’s how debt at graduation distributes across borrowers:

Percentile Debt at graduation
10th $2,122.00
25th $3,750.00
Median (50th) $9,500.00
75th $14,557.00
90th $24,500.00

The distance from the 10th to the 90th percentile shows how widely debt outcomes vary.
